Barcode Scanner Integration — Account Recovery (ScanBridge)

If a merchant's ScanBridge account gets locked after too many pairing failures, don't just reset it — the scanner firmware caches the old token and you'll end up in a loop. First, unpair the device in the Hexling admin panel, then trigger "Force Recovery" and wait for the amber LED. The console will prompt you to re-authenticate the integration account. When prompted, enter the recovery passphrase shown below.

unlock words, yawig-kagef: gordor-holvan-ulaael-pramir-ulaiel-tamdor

Plugin authors extending the Quartermill admin grid should route all bulk edits through the batch endpoint rather than looping single-row updates; the latter bypasses audit hooks and will be rejected in the next release. Batches are capped at 200 rows and validated atomically — one bad row fails the whole batch, so pre-validate client-side. Soft-deleted rows are excluded unless your plugin declares the restore capability. Before testing against the sandbox, your plugin must load the configuration values below.

service settings:
[silwyn]
host = silwyn.crelvogrid.internal
user = silwyn_svc
database = silwyn_prod

Hello plugin authors,

Next Thursday, Corbexa will run a disaster-recovery drill for the RestockRoute vending-machine restock planner. During the failover window, plugin callbacks will be replayed against the standby scheduler, so please ensure your handlers are idempotent and tolerate duplicate route assignments. No customer restock data will be altered. To re-register your plugin against the standby environment during the drill, authenticate with the recovery passphrase provided below.

vault phrase of hahip-tajeg = quenax-briath-briax

// Config hot-reloading for the Brindlemere client.
// The watcher polls /etc/brindlemere/client.toml every 15s and applies
// changes without a restart. Connection pool size, retry budgets, and
// timeout values are all reloadable; endpoint URLs are not, by design,
// since swapping hosts mid-flight corrupted the session cache in the
// 3.2 release. Reload events are logged at INFO so the release manager
// can confirm rollout without shelling in. The client authenticates to
// the internal Fennic registry with the key that follows.

app token of tageg-kadug = vxb2-26